Sheridan pounces to AHDC win

Freehold, NJ – Yogi Sheridan sat a pocket trip and capitalized on the circumstances to win behind Lionhead in the $9,000 American Harness Drivers Club Trot at Freehold Raceway on Saturday (March 2).

Leaving from post five, Sheridan lunged for the lead with Lionhead and cleared pylon-starter Train (driven by Paul Minore) to a :30 first quarter. Grafenberg (Joe Faraldo) – sitting in third – soon came off the pegs and swung towards the lead moving for the half, timed in 1:01.3. Grafenberg led the field up the backside with Lionhead on his helmet and the rest of the field chasing in behind.

Past three-quarters in 1:30.4, Grafenberg remained strong on the lead until jumping stride through the final turn, leaving Lionhead to inherit the lead spinning for home.

And once in front, Lionhead sprung forward to a 2-1/4-length win in 2:01.1 over second-place finisher Grafenberg, who was placed seventh for a lapped-on break. Hammer Creek (John Calabrese) moved to the runner-up spot with Warrawee Preferred (Joe Lee) taking third and Winneress (Anthony Verruso) fourth.

Terry Morgan owns and trains Lionhead, an 8-year-old gelding by Uncle Peter. He paid $4 to win.
